Show COPPER-URANIUM PROPER- TY LOOKS BETTER DAILY 4 The latest word from the Copper-Uranium Copper-Uranium property, that Lost River, Idaho, prospect In which many Logan-Ites Logan-Ites are interested, sounds good to the stockholders. James Shall, manager, writes Messrs. Fames and Turner that another car ot ore will soon be ready for shipment, and that at the bottom of a fifty foot shaft, sunk all the way through ore, ruby copper, black oxide and native copper Is being taxen out. He says that anr ot this will average 25 per cent copper and that It is there in quantity. One man in two hours took from the bottom of the shaft twenty-tiree sacks of superb ore. In the various drifts oro is encountered and they have a titty-foot stoplng ground with ore all the way down or up. All about the prospect are feeling jubilant at the possibilities, and the scheme is to continue on to get depth. With each foot of depth oro has grown richer and Indications of permanency greater. Mr. Shall is regarded as a conservative man and his expressions are taken at their fullest face value. There Is no difficulty In disposing of stock. |
